What Are the Best Breakfast Dishes at Strong Hearts Cafe?
- The Full Strong Hearts Breakfast: A hearty spread of tofu scramble, home fries, toast, and seasonal fruit that keeps you full all morning.
- Pancake Stack: Fluffy, golden pancakes served with maple syrup and fresh berry compote — a weekly ritual for many regulars.
- Breakfast Burrito: Spiced scrambled tofu, black beans, and roasted peppers wrapped tight in a warm tortilla.
- French Toast: Thick-cut bread soaked in a cinnamon-vanilla batter, pan-fried to perfection.
- Avocado Toast: A generous smear of fresh avocado on grilled sourdough with everything bagel seasoning.
- House Granola Bowl: Crunchy granola, creamy oat milk, and fresh banana slices make this a light but satisfying start.
